Skip to content
parts>suspension>shocks

Collection: parts>suspension>shocks

136 products

DR MOTO
Finance Enquire about our finance options on Motorcycles
*LOWER SHOCK BEARING KIT PSYCHIC HONDA CRF150R 07-ON

*LOWER SHOCK BEARING KIT PSYCHIC HONDA CRF150R 07-ON

Regular price $29.95
Sale price $29.95 Regular price
MONOSHOCK_SEMI SYNTHETIC 1L

1L Mono Shock Fluid Semi Synthetic Shock Absorber Oil IPONE (800202)

Regular price $39.00
Sale price $39.00 Regular price
ALL BALLS CONTROL ARM KIT LOWER CAN-AM DEFENDER OUTLANDER RENEGADE

ALL BALLS CONTROL ARM KIT LOWER CAN-AM DEFENDER OUTLANDER RENEGADE

Regular price $25.96
Sale price $25.96 Regular price
ALL BALLS CONTROL ARM KIT LOWER OR UPPER CAN-AM DEFENDER OUTLANDER RENEGADE

ALL BALLS CONTROL ARM KIT LOWER OR UPPER CAN-AM DEFENDER OUTLANDER RENEGADE

Regular price $79.95
Sale price $79.95 Regular price
ALL BALLS CONTROL ARM KIT LOWER OR UPPER SUZUKI LT A AF Z VINSON LT F

ALL BALLS CONTROL ARM KIT LOWER OR UPPER SUZUKI LT A AF Z VINSON LT F

Regular price $109.95
Sale price $109.95 Regular price
ALL BALLS CONTROL ARM KIT LOWER OR UPPER YAMAHA YFM YFS YFZ

ALL BALLS CONTROL ARM KIT LOWER OR UPPER YAMAHA YFM YFS YFZ

Regular price $124.95
Sale price $124.95 Regular price
ALL BALLS CONTROL ARM KIT LOWER OR UPPER YAMAHA YFM700R YFM125R YFM250R YFZ350 YFZ450R

ALL BALLS CONTROL ARM KIT LOWER OR UPPER YAMAHA YFM700R YFM125R YFM250R YFZ350 YFZ450R

Regular price $74.95
Sale price $74.95 Regular price
ALL BALLS CV BOOT REBUILD KIT FRONT CAN-AM HONDA KAWASAKI KTM POLARIS SUZUKI YAMAHA

ALL BALLS CV BOOT REBUILD KIT FRONT CAN-AM HONDA KAWASAKI KTM POLARIS SUZUKI YAMAHA

Regular price $47.95
Sale price $47.95 Regular price
ALL BALLS INDEPENDENT SUSPENSION KIT REAR SUZUKI LT A500 09-20 LT A500F 09-16 LT A750 08-20

ALL BALLS INDEPENDENT SUSPENSION KIT REAR SUZUKI LT A500 09-20 LT A500F 09-16 LT A750 08-20

Regular price $249.95
Sale price $249.95 Regular price
ALL BALLS LINKAGE BEARING KIT GAS GAS EC MC SM

ALL BALLS LINKAGE BEARING KIT GAS GAS EC MC SM

Regular price $219.95
Sale price $219.95 Regular price
ALL BALLS LINKAGE BEARING KIT HONDA CRF100F XR100 01-13

ALL BALLS LINKAGE BEARING KIT HONDA CRF100F XR100 01-13

Regular price $204.95
Sale price $204.95 Regular price
ALL BALLS LINKAGE BEARING KIT HONDA CRF125F 14-21

ALL BALLS LINKAGE BEARING KIT HONDA CRF125F 14-21

Regular price $204.95
Sale price $204.95 Regular price
ALL BALLS LINKAGE BEARING KIT HONDA CRF150R 07-20

ALL BALLS LINKAGE BEARING KIT HONDA CRF150R 07-20

Regular price $226.95
Sale price $226.95 Regular price
ALL BALLS LINKAGE BEARING KIT HONDA CRF250R CRF250RX CRF450L CRF450R CRF450RX CRF450X

ALL BALLS LINKAGE BEARING KIT HONDA CRF250R CRF250RX CRF450L CRF450R CRF450RX CRF450X

Regular price $194.95
Sale price $194.95 Regular price
ALL BALLS LINKAGE BEARING KIT HONDA CTX200 02-21

ALL BALLS LINKAGE BEARING KIT HONDA CTX200 02-21

Regular price $199.95
Sale price $199.95 Regular price
ALL BALLS LINKAGE BEARING KIT HONDA XR100 85-13 XR80 85-03

ALL BALLS LINKAGE BEARING KIT HONDA XR100 85-13 XR80 85-03

Regular price $204.95
Sale price $204.95 Regular price
ALL BALLS LINKAGE BEARING KIT HONDA XR100 XR80 CRF100F CRF150F CRF230F

ALL BALLS LINKAGE BEARING KIT HONDA XR100 XR80 CRF100F CRF150F CRF230F

Regular price $199.95
Sale price $199.95 Regular price
ALL BALLS LINKAGE BEARING KIT KAWASAKI KDX200 95-06 KDX220 97-05 KX125 KX250 94-97

ALL BALLS LINKAGE BEARING KIT KAWASAKI KDX200 95-06 KDX220 97-05 KX125 KX250 94-97

Regular price $199.95
Sale price $199.95 Regular price
ALL BALLS LINKAGE BEARING KIT KAWASAKI KLX140 08-20

ALL BALLS LINKAGE BEARING KIT KAWASAKI KLX140 08-20

Regular price $204.95
Sale price $204.95 Regular price

parts>suspension>shocks